Transaction 7589a8ce125de0c53adbfb192ef769d35d2d17d41da9087d35ae716af34ca46b

1 Input
1 Outputs
  • 7589a8ce125de0c53adbfb192ef769d35d2d17d41da9087d35ae716af34ca46b:0
  • value  11777191
    address  36QWj9djteVp8xLG6vreJwp5LZ7r59v5c2